Supervisor, Sample Management

ICON plc is a world-leading healthcare intelligence and clinical research organization. We're proud to foster an inclusive environment driving innovation and excellence, and we welcome you to join us on our mission to shape the future of clinical development.

We are currently seeking a Supervisor, Sample Management to join our diverse and dynamic team. As a Supervisor, Sample Management at ICON, you will play a critical role in overseeing the management, processing, and distribution of biological samples within clinical trials. You will ensure compliance with quality standards and regulatory requirements, contributing to the successful execution of research protocols and the advancement of innovative therapies.

What You Will Be Doing:

  • Overseeing the day-to-day operations of the sample management laboratory, including sample receipt, processing, storage, and shipment.
  • Ensuring compliance with applicable regulations, quality standards, and internal policies related to sample management.
  • Collaborating with cross-functional teams to ensure timely and accurate sample processing in support of clinical trial activities.
  • Managing inventory control and tracking systems to maintain proper documentation and chain of custody for all samples.
  • Providing leadership and training to sample management staff, fostering a culture of continuous improvement and quality assurance.

Your Profile:

  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ant scientific discipline, such as biology, chemistry, or a related field.
  • Experience in sample management, biobanking, or laboratory operations within a clinical research environment.
  • Strong knowledge of regulatory requirements and best practices related to sample handling and storage.
  • Excellent leadership, organizational, and communication sk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ities effectively.
  • Detail-oriented with a strong commitment to maintaining high standards of quality and compliance.
